• The Director, Democratic and Inclusive Societies plays a pivotal role within the Strategic Growth group of FHI 360 Global Operations. • Tasked with driving strategic growth and impact. • Oversees the Democratic and Inclusive Societies team, ensuring alignment with organizational priorities. • Foster collaboration both internally and externally. • Lead a diverse team of technical experts, navigating complex issues. • Spearheading initiatives to secure new business opportunities and advance FHI 360’s strategic goals.
• Master’s Degree or its international equivalent in civil society, international development, political science, international relations, public policy, social sciences, or a related field. • Minimum of 10 years of relevant professional experience and a master’s degree or, in lieu of a master’s degree, a bachelor’s degree and 13 years of experience would be considered. • Minimum of 10 years working internationally in civil society strengthening, civic participation, and/or conflict mitigation or related fields. • Experience partnering with major international funding agencies, private sector, and/or foundations. • Extensive experience partnering with USAID required. • Strong time-management, multi-tasking, and organizational skills. • Excellent oral and written communication skills. • Strong consultative and negotiation skills. • Strong critical thinking and problem-solving skills to plan, organize, and manage resources for successful completion of projects. • Excellent and demonstrated public relations, policy development, project management and diplomacy skills required. • Fluency in English required; proficiency in additional languages preferred.
• FHI 360 contributes 12% of monthly base pay to a money purchase pension plan account. • All US based staff working full-time receive 18 days of paid vacation per year. • 12 sick days per year. • 11 holidays per year. • Paid time off is reduced pro rata for employees working less than a full-time schedule.
